Bed linens in 100% Extra-Long Staple Cotton sateen 300 t.c., Made in Italy
The Masaccio Striped collection is a timeless bed décor. The unique Signoria long-staple cotton sateen is defined by this elegant striped sateen fabric, possessing the wonderful silky touch and shiny look this type of weave naturally exhibits. An elegant plain sateen border is applied on the flanges of the pillowcases and on the top edge of the flat sheet. Duvet covers, flat sheets, pillowcases, bottom sheets (with or without elastic), quilted coverlets and any other item can be produced in any size. Made in Italy.

Machine wash lukewarm water, from 85°F (30°C) to 105°F (40°C), delicate cycle; use a mild detergent; cold rinse; Do noy use bleach; Wash linens separately from other fabrics, separate light & dark colors; Tumble dry low heat (delicate dry cycle), remove while damp for less wrinkling; iron if desired on medium heat.

All Signoria Firenze products include a care label sewn into each product. In addition, please refer to the fabric care label for recommended care for each item.

Any reference to thread count (TC) refers to the commonly accepted commercial definition of the number of yarns per square inch including 2 ply yarns for obtaining total thread count. It is not a reference to the “technical” definition as promulgated by ASTM Standard D 3775 which considers 2 or more ply yarns as one thread or end. Applying D 3775 to multiple ply yarns will result in a lower technical thread count than the commercial definition.
